Faulty Kitchen Sink


The kitchen sink is an essential as well as most made use of part of the kitchen area. It is susceptible to water damage; damages such as obstructed pipes, leaky pipelines, and faulty taps.
These damages can be frustrating, particularly when one is busy in the cooking area. It does not just take place without providing a clue or an indicator. So right here are some indicators to understand when your sink is not okay
  • When draining water right into the skin makes a gurgling sound and also creates air bubbles while experiencing the sink. It implies that something is obstructing the pipes of the sink.

  • An additional indication of a blocked drainpipe is the sluggish movement of water. Normally, water passes through a sink right away, so if you start seeing delay, there is a clog in the pipes.

  • The following indication is an offensive smell; this reveals that the pipes are obstructed, as well as stale food is piling in the pipelines. This issue needs a quick fix, so the scent does not overtake your residence.

  • Leaking faucets and also pipes likewise can be an issue. It makes your kitchen area damp as well as unpleasant, particularly when trickling from the pipes. And also if it is dripping from the tap, it leads to water waste.

  • These are the significant problems that can happen to your cooking area sink. One means to stop this damage is by making certain that food particles do not get right into the pipes. You are also inspecting the taps and also pipes as well as making certain that it is properly repaired as well as in good condition.

    Dripping Dishwasher


    Dishwashing machines make life in the kitchen area less complicated. However, it is an optional kitchen home appliance and also, when available, can be a source of water damage. Additionally, like various other makers, it will certainly develop faults in time, even with upkeep.
    One of the faults is leaking with the door or underneath the dish washer. These mistakes create as a result of age, splits, incorrect use, loose links to pipes, etc.
    Faults due to age come from constant usage. Because of this, the door leaks because of closing and also opening up.
    Additionally, mistakes from the incorrect use may trigger water damage by introducing cracks to it. It is a good idea to comply with the manual guide of the dish washer to avoid this specific damage.
    The leakages under the dishwashing machine can come from splits in the gasket, pipe, and wrong or loosened connection to water pipes or drains pipes.
    This type of leakage commonly goes unnoticed and also can be there for a very long time. However, because of the moment structure, it might damage the flooring as well as cause mold growth.
    Much more so, the longer the water stays, you will certainly discover the bending of the floor where the dishwasher is. This is an excellent indication to look out for when checking if your dish washer leaks. Identifying and repairing this on time protects against major water damage to your floor covering.

    Faulty Drain Piping


    Drain Pipelines are required parts of our residences, particularly in our shower rooms and also kitchens. They get malfunctioning by obtaining blocked, split, and ruptured. Or even worse, they can be wrongly or freely connected; whichever the situation might be, it can be a severe issue.
    Faulty drain pipelines can cause water damage as well as, therefore, cause mold and mildew development and damage the appearance of your wall. It can likewise make the damaged area look untidy.
    Consequently, it is advisable always to examine to ensure that all the pipes remain in good condition and also get a sound pipes system to keep and repair any type of concerns.

    Common Causes of Water damage in your kitchen




  • Pipe problems are the most common source of water leaks under your sink. If homeowners ignore this issue, it will burst and flood the kitchen.


  • Dishwasher leaks can be a source of water damage in your kitchen. An old, broken, and defective dishwasher can cause leaks, damage to your floor, and even mold growth.


  • Refrigerator leaks can cause water damage in your kitchen, as sometimes melted ice from defrosting can cause leaks. Furthermore, if your refrigerator has internal problems, it is very likely to cause water damage.


  • Back-splash and sink caulking can cause discoloration and water damage to your countertop tiles.

    Regular maintenance


    The most important thing you can do to protect your kitchen from water damage is to inspect the sinks, drains, and pipes, as well as the kitchen appliances, regularly. As with the sink, check for missing or deteriorated caulk. Remove the old caulk and clean the area thoroughly and re-seal it with fresh silicone. Furthermore, sweep the drain regularly, empty the filter and dispose of the debris in the garbage, and inspect the supply lines and valve for cracks.

    Garbage clean-up


    Fats, oil, and grease are common in the kitchen. Pouring them down the drain can cause clogs and sewage backup, which may result in significant kitchen water damage. If your kitchen sink is clogged, use a solution of hot water, baking soda, and vinegar to unclog the fats and oils in the pipes. Also, make sure to throw out the debris in the trash and clean the sink properly using paper towels for greases and oil and soap or bleach solution for the sink itself.


    Shut off your water line


    Make sure to shut off your main water line, especially if you're away and having some flood issue. As mentioned, dishwasher leaks are one of the most common culprits of water damage in the kitchen. So, make sure to only use the dishwasher if someone is at home and available to attend in case a problem arises.



    Furthermore, it is also important that every member of your household knows where the shut-off valves are located. So in case of an emergency, they can mitigate the damage by turning off the water source.


    Install leak detectors


    One of the best ways to catch water damage before it could even cause serious damage to your home or business is by installing a water or leak detector. A leak detector monitors the flow of water through a pipeline, can detect moisture in the air for molds, and tracks the water temperature. Also, it can shut off your water line in case of an emergency. Install leak detectors under the kitchen sink, near the dishwasher and refrigerator.
